Marriage is a very funny thing: it can be one of the best things you ever experienced or one of the worst. Sometimes it makes you feel happy and on top of the world. Other times, it makes you feel miserable and like you made the biggest mistake of your life.
Love is important but the longer I stay with my husband, I wonder if love is enough. I love him dearly and we did live together before marriage. However, no matter how long you live together before your wedding day, you can't possibly imagine every scenario you both will encounter during marriage. Therefore, surprises can and do happen.
That same spouse who was your best friend can one day make you wish your marriage license had an expiration date.
Those of us women who married later in life often couldn't wait for our days of being single to end. But as my mom wisely said,"It's better to wish you WERE married than to wish you WEREN'T."
I do love my husband but many days, I no longer understand him or feel fully loved by him. He does love me, I'm sure, but lately it feels like everyone else and everything else matter to him more than our marriage.
But as an old-school gal, I'm just not ready to walk away and give up. Go figure. If this were a job, I'd quit though or seriously consider it.
